What action follows ACTIVE PNR in the path?

Explanation:
In a reservation workflow, an ACTIVE PNR means the passenger record is loaded and ready to be worked on. The next step is to press Enter to load the PNR details into your working screen, moving you from simply having the record active to actively interacting with its data. This is the natural progression because Enter opens or confirms the selection so you can view or modify the information. Saving would come after making changes, cancelling would abort the operation, and viewing might display the data but doesn’t advance you into editing or processing the record. So the action that follows ACTIVE PNR is Enter.
